PROBLEM TO BE SOLVED: To secure long-term preserving performance of paste containing a hydrogen storage alloy, and improve productivity of an electrode by adding polyethylene imine as a dispersant, preventing adsorption to a hydrogen storage alloy surface of a water soluble high polymer of a thickener when paste is left as it is, and restraining viscosity reduction in the paste. SOLUTION: Molecular weight of polyethylene imine included in paste is desirable to be 500 to 100000 in average molecular weight, and a quantity of the polyethylene imine is desirable to be 0.01 to 5 pts.wt. to 100 pts.wt. of a hydrogen storage alloy. For example, polyvinyl alcohol, methyl cellulose, polyethylene oxide and carboxymethyl cellulose are used as a thickener. For example, a rubber high polymer such as a styrene-butadiene copolymer, natural rubber and a styrene-acrylic acid copolymer and polytetrafluoroethylene may be added in the paste as a binder. Therefore, discharge capacity can be improved. |
